Two Accounts - Academic Coach Account and Admin Account
Academic coaches have a teacher account and an admin account.
Your teacher account...
allows you to see what a teacher sees when they are accessing CompassLearning.
allows you to access the district level assessments and TestBuilder information, which teachers cannot see currently.
allows you to assign the district level assessments to the students.
Your admin account...
allows you to add new teachers to your building.
allows you to delete past teachers from your building.
allows you to reset teacher passwords.
allows you to delete assignments and classes of any teacher in your building.
allows you to view and print reports beyond what a classroom teacher will need.
Login with your username (MUNIS number) and password (first initial, last initial, and last 4 of SSN).
Go to the MY STUDENTS tab.
Click on MY CLASSES from the left column of the window.
Click NEW and CLASS to create a new class to hold your CORE students, or EDIT the existing class to update it. You should have 5 classes at the minimum (1st Grade CORE, 2nd Grade CORE, 3rd Grade CORE, 4th Grade CORE, and 5th Grade CORE). Additional classes will be needed when it is time to assign selected students to either the PREREQUISITE or ENRICHMENT tests.
Click MY SCHOOL and then STUDENTS in the left column.
Click the tiny down arrows by NARROW BY ATTRIBUTES at the bottom left corner of the window. A hidden section will open.
Checkmark one grade level, then click NARROW by the green arrow. You will see only students for that one grade level. This is an improvement over last year.
Click the selection button by the FIRST NAME column.
Click on CHECK ALL. All students from that grade level will be selected.
Click ACTIONS and then ADD TO CLASS.
Select the CORE class for that group of students, then ADD.
Before moving to next group of students, click on the selection button by the FIRST NAME Column and then click UNCHECK ALL.
Repeat steps 7-13 for remaining grade levels.
Students in grades 1-5 should now be in a class for the CORE group. Now, assign the correct assessment to each CORE group.
Assigning the District Level Assessments to Classes
Click on the COURSES & ASSIGNMENTS tab.
Click the ASSIGNMENTS ARCHIVE button.
Use the SEARCH tool in the left column to narrow your assignment search.
Choose DISTRICT under Availability, MATH under Subject, Correct grade under Grade, ACTIVE under Status, and type "12-13" in the Keyword section. Click SEARCH.
Checkmark the CORE Pretest to assign.
Click the blue and white ASSIGN TO STUDENTS button from the top of the section.
Checkmark the name of the class, and all students in the class will be selected.
Click Finish.
Repeat for other CORE Pretests
